摘要
Densities (rho), speeds of sound (u) and refractive index (nu) for the binary mixture of 1-Butyl-3-methylimidazolium bis(trifluoromethylsulfonyl)imide [Bmim] [NTf2] with N-Vinyl-2-pyrrolidinone (NVP) over the entire range of composition and at temperatures ranging from 298.15 K to 323.15 K at 0.1 MPa pressure, are reported in this investigation. From the experimental data, excess molar volumes (V-m(E)), excess molar compressibilities (k(s)(E)), excess molar isentropic compressibilities (K-s,m(E)), excess speeds of sound (u(E)), and deviation in molar refraction (Delta R-m) are calculated and fitted with Redlich-Kister polynomial smoothing equation. Excess molar volumes are predicted through PFP theory and the results are compared with experimental findings (C) 2017 Elsevier Ltd.
